Jobbeschreibung

Senior Research Engineer - Computer Vision & Surgical Navigation (m/f/d)

24 Aug 2026

As a young and dynamic eHealth company, FUSE-AI pursues the goal of improving medical care with innovative AI-based software products. Building on our established medical imaging solutions, we are developing navigation and assistance systems for the next generation of precision surgery. At FUSE-AI, we work together in an interdisciplinary team of data scientists, machine learning engineers, Q&R experts and scientists for the use of AI solutions in medicine.

Job Description
  • Design and development of surgical navigation software, including registration and real-time data processing
  • Development of machine learning / deep learning approaches for MRI and other medical imaging domains, from model design to deployment
  • Planning, implementation and integration of software components
  • Feasibility analyses of problems regarding computer vision, artificial intelligence and robotic assistance, and the development of suitable solution strategies
  • Support in the selection and integration of suitable tools, frameworks and technologies to improve our development and deployment
  • Systematic evaluation and validation of developed approaches, as well as further development and optimization of our products/projects
  • Independent study of state of the art knowledge
Qualification and Competences
  • A successfully completed degree in (technical) computer science, medical engineering, robotics, physics or a comparable scientific discipline. If academic qualifications or further education are not sufficient to demonstrate software engineering, programming and development-related skills, evidence of an equivalent level needs to be demonstrated.
  • Several years of experience in computer vision / image processing / 3D perception
  • Experience in machine learning / deep learning as a confident user of established methods
  • Experience with medical image analysis and image registration
  • Proficiency in real-time, performance-critical software development, in particular C++
  • Experienced in Python and AI-related frameworks
  • Experience in working on Linux-based infrastructure
  • Knowledge in common computer vision and imaging libraries (e.g. OpenCV, ITK/VTK, PyTorch)
  • Experience with processing of image, depth or spectral data
  • Proficiency in software engineering in collaboration with Git
  • Competent in concepts for software development procedures, agile project development methodologies and project management (e.g. Jira, MS Project, etc.)
  • Competent in requirement engineering regarding to usability and clinical indication
  • Good communication in balance with respect, kindness and feedback culture
  • Hands‑on mentality and problem‑solving mindset in accordance with best practice and requirements
  • Independent structured manner of working and interest in collaboration and further development in an interdisciplinary team
  • Proficiency in German and English communication
Nice‑to‑haves
  • Knowledge and understanding of medical and clinical workflows, ideally in the context of surgical navigation or image‑guided surgery (e.g. 3D Slicer, MITK, IGSTK)
  • Experience with medical image segmentation
  • Experience with robotics software frameworks
  • Knowledge of medical device regulations (EU MDR, FDA, ISO, etc.)
